Student Success KPI: Transfer-out Rate
Definition: Transfer-out rate refers to the total number of students from the fall cohort who are known to have transferred out of the institution (without earning a degree/award) and subsequently re-enrolled at another institution within the same time period; divided by the same adjusted cohort (initial cohort minus allowable exclusions).
Note: From the Fall 2008 and Fall 2009 first-time, degree-seeking students, 31% transferred to four-year universities. Thirty-three percent (33%) of these transferred students graduated from four-year colleges in the last seven years.
